Skip links

The benefits of Open Source AI for businesses

Artificial Intelligence (AI) has emerged as a transformative technology, revolutionizing various industries. Among the different AI solutions, open source AI stands out, offering unique advantages to businesses. Understanding these benefits can help companies leverage AI more effectively and economically.

Cost efficiency

One of the most significant benefits is cost efficiency. Traditional AI solutions often require expensive licenses and subscription fees. In contrast, these tools are typically free to use, allowing businesses to experiment and implement AI technologies without incurring hefty upfront costs. By reducing financial barriers, companies of all sizes can access cutting-edge AI capabilities.

Flexibility and customisation

These tools offer unparalleled flexibility. Businesses can modify the source code to tailor the AI solutions to their specific needs. This customisation is crucial for companies that require unique functionalities not available in off-the-shelf AI products. By tweaking the source code, businesses can develop AI models that precisely match their operational requirements, enhancing efficiency and effectiveness.

Faster innovation

The collaborative nature of open source AI fosters faster innovation. Developers and researchers from around the world contribute to projects, continuously improving and expanding the capabilities of these tools. Businesses can benefit from this collective expertise, accessing the latest advancements and updates more quickly than if they relied solely on proprietary solutions.

Community support and resources

These projects often come with extensive community support. Developers and users actively participate in forums, share knowledge, and provide solutions to common problems. This community-driven support can be invaluable, offering access to a wealth of resources and expertise. Additionally, comprehensive documentation and tutorials are usually available, aiding in the seamless implementation and troubleshooting of AI solutions.

Transparency and security

Transparency is a key advantage. Since the source code is publicly accessible, businesses can thoroughly inspect it for security vulnerabilities. This openness ensures that the AI tools are trustworthy and reliable. Moreover, the ability to review and audit the code helps companies comply with regulatory requirements, an increasingly important aspect in today’s data-driven world.

Scalability

These solutions are highly scalable, making them suitable for businesses of all sizes. Whether a company is a startup or a large enterprise, it can deploy AI at a scale that matches its growth and needs. This scalability ensures that as a business expands, its AI capabilities can grow in tandem, providing continuous support for evolving operations.

Interoperability

Many tools are designed to be interoperable with other software and platforms. This compatibility allows businesses to integrate AI seamlessly into their existing technology stack. By facilitating smooth interactions between different systems, these tools enhance overall operational efficiency and streamline workflows.

Ethical AI development

Open source promotes ethical AI development. The transparency and collaborative nature of these projects encourage the creation of AI solutions that are fair, unbiased, and responsible. Businesses adopting these tools can contribute to and benefit from these ethical standards, ensuring that their AI implementations align with societal values and expectations.

Here are some of the most widely used open source AI tools that businesses can leverage to enhance their operations:

TensorFlow

Developed by Google Brain, TensorFlow is an open source deep learning framework widely used for machine learning and neural network research.

Key features: Flexibility, extensive library, strong community support, and tools for deploying AI models on various platforms.

PyTorch

An open source machine learning library developed by Facebook’s AI Research lab, PyTorch is known for its ease of use and dynamic computational graph.

Key features: Intuitive interface, extensive support for deep learning applications, and a growing community.

HuggingFace

A leading open source library for natural language processing (NLP) tasks, known for its Transformers library.

Key features: State-of-the-art models for NLP, extensive documentation, and strong community support.

Mistral AI

A new player in the open source AI field, focusing on high-performance machine learning models and tools.

Key features: Cutting-edge research, open collaboration, and tools designed for scalable AI applications.

LangChain

An open source framework for developing applications using large language models (LLMs).

Key features: Easy integration with various LLMs, tools for prompt engineering, and support for building complex language-based applications.

LanceDB

An open source database optimised for machine learning applications, providing fast data retrieval and management.

Key features: High performance, scalability, and integration with popular machine learning frameworks.

Scikit-Learn

A machine learning library for the Python programming language, Scikit-Learn is built on NumPy, SciPy, and Matplotlib.

Key features: Simple and efficient tools for data mining and data analysis, well-documented, and versatile for various machine learning tasks.

There are many players in the open source AI arena, offering numerous benefits for businesses. Open source AI solutions provide cost savings, customisation, faster innovation, and strong community support. By leveraging these advantages and utilising popular open source AI tools, companies can enhance their operational efficiency, drive innovation, and stay competitive. Open source AI democratises access to advanced technologies and promotes ethical, transparent development. For businesses looking to harness the power of AI, open source solutions are a compelling and strategic choice.